What is Content Length?
Content length refers to the number of words, characters, or pages that make up a piece of content on a website. This can vary widely depending on the type of content and the topic being covered.
The Role of Content-Length in SEO
Content length can have a significant impact on a website's SEO performance for several reasons:
Keyword Optimization: Longer content allows for more opportunities to incorporate relevant keywords naturally. This can help improve a website's visibility in search results for those keywords, leading to increased organic traffic.
Comprehensive Coverage: Longer content tends to be more comprehensive and in-depth, providing more value to readers. Search engines value high-quality content that addresses users' needs and provides valuable information, which can lead to higher rankings in search results.
User Engagement: Longer content has the potential to engage users for a more extended period, increasing dwell time and reducing bounce rates. This signals to search engines that the content is valuable and relevant, which can positively impact rankings.
Backlink Potential: Longer content tends to attract more backlinks from other websites, as it is seen as more authoritative and informative. Backlinks are a crucial ranking factor in SEO, so generating high-quality backlinks can help improve a website's search engine ranking.
Finding the Right Balance
While longer content can have its benefits, it's essential to strike the right balance and ensure that the length of your content aligns with the needs and preferences of your target audience. Here are a few tips for finding the right balance:
Quality Over Quantity: Focus on creating high-quality content that provides value to your audience, rather than simply aiming for a specific word count. Quality should always be the top priority.
Audience Research: Understand your target audience's preferences and expectations when it comes to content length. Some topics may require more in-depth coverage, while others may be better suited to shorter, more concise content.
Keyword Research: Conduct thorough keyword research to identify relevant keywords and phrases that you can incorporate naturally into your content. This will help improve your visibility in search results and attract more organic traffic.
Regular Updates: Keep your content up-to-date and relevant by regularly updating and refreshing it with new information. This will not only improve your search engine ranking but also keep your audience engaged and coming back for more.
